首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 移动开发 > 移动开发 >

objective-c id的意思

2012-07-25 
objective-cid的意义id用于指代任意实体对象的存放路径;比如说id=(NSString *)id=(NSDictionary *)?如果一

objective-c id的意义

id用于指代任意实体对象的存放路径;

比如说id=(NSString *)

id=(NSDictionary *)

?

如果一个函数的参数是id

那么此处需要传指针值,比如说NSString *test=[NSString allo] init];

那么传输的参数是test;

?

如果一个函数的参数是(id *)

那么此处需要传指针值的索引值,比如说NSString *test=[NSString allo] init];

那么传输的参数是&test;


example:
NSString *testparam=[NSString allo] init];第一种情况:-(void) testid:(id)param;调用方式:testid:testparam;
第一种情况:-(void) testid:(id *)param;调用方式:testid:&testparam;


热点排行